PGATOUR.COM’s Expert Picks for the Crowne Plaza Invitational at Colonial are now available. You can check out how the draft went this week by clicking here.
Last year’s champion, Zach Johnson, returns to defend. Other past champions in the field include Sergio Garcia, Rory Sabbatini and Champions Tour stars Tom Lehman and Kenny Perry.
Our experts also liked Ben Crane, Hunter Mahan, David Toms and Jim Furyk among others to contend this week.
